SubjectRe: [PATCH] taint/module: Fix problems when out-of-kernel driver defines true or false
On Sun 2017-01-01 20:25:25, Larry Finger wrote:
> Commit 7fd8329ba502 ("taint/module: Clean up global and module taint
> flags handling") used the key words true and false as character members
> of a new struct. These names cause problems when out-of-kernel modules
> such as VirtualBox include their own definitions of true and false.
